Understanding Polyfax Cream and its Uses

Polyfax cream contains two active ingredients: Polymyxin B sulfate and Bacitracin zinc. These potent antibacterial agents work synergistically to combat a wide range of bacteria that commonly cause skin infections.

Polyfax cream is primarily prescribed for the treatment of:

  • Infected wounds: Polyfax helps prevent infections in minor cuts, burns, and abrasions.
  • Impetigo: This contagious bacterial infection, characterized by sores on the face, is effectively treated with Polyfax.
  • Folliculitis: Polyfax can help clear up inflamed hair follicles caused by bacterial infections.
  • Eczema and Dermatitis: While not a primary treatment, Polyfax may be used to manage secondary bacterial infections in eczema and dermatitis cases.

How to Use Polyfax Cream

It’s crucial to use Polyfax cream as directed by your doctor or pharmacist. The general guidelines for application include:

  1. Wash your hands thoroughly.
  2. Cleanse the affected area gently with mild soap and water. Pat dry with a clean towel.
  3. Apply a thin layer of Polyfax cream to the affected area, gently massaging it into the skin.
  4. Wash your hands again after application.
  5. Use the cream regularly as prescribed, even if symptoms improve, to ensure complete eradication of the infection.

Important Note: Polyfax cream is intended for external use only. Avoid contact with your eyes, nose, and mouth.

Potential Side Effects of Polyfax Cream

While Polyfax cream is generally safe for use, some individuals may experience mild side effects, such as:

  • Skin irritation: This may manifest as redness, itching, burning, or dryness at the application site.
  • Allergic reactions: Though rare, allergic reactions to Polyfax can occur.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ience symptoms like hives, difficulty breathing, or sw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at.

If you encounter any persistent or concerning side effects, it’s essential to discontinue use and consult your doctor promptly.

Frequently Asked Questions about Polyfax Cream

Q1: Can I use Polyfax cream on my face?

While Polyfax is generally safe for facial application, it’s best to avoid the sensitive areas around your eyes and mouth.

Q2: How long does it take for Polyfax cream to work?

You should start noticing improvement in your skin condition within a few days of using Polyfax cream. However, it’s crucial to complete the entire prescribed course to prevent the infection from recurring.

Q3: Can I use Polyfax cream on my child?

It’s not advisable to use Polyfax cream on infants or children without consulting a pediatrician.

Q4: Can I buy Polyfax cream over the counter in Pakistan?

Yes, Polyfax cream is readily available over the counter at most pharmacies in Pakistan. However, it’s always recommended to consult a doctor before starting any new medication.

Q5: What should I do if I miss a dose of Polyfax cream?

If you miss a dose, apply it as soon as you remember. However, if it’s alm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ular schedule.
